
var partidos_todos;

function cargarPartidos(todos)
{
	var strIdProvincia = document.getElementById("provincia");
	partidos_todos = (todos?true:false);
	if(strIdProvincia)
	{
		IdProvincia = strIdProvincia.options[strIdProvincia.selectedIndex].value;
		var cargador = new net.CargadorContenidos("http://"+window.location.host+"/descarga.php?a=partidos&parametros="+URLEnc("provincia="+IdProvincia+"&rnd="+Math.random()),PoblarPartidos,ErrorPartidos);
	}
	else
	{
		alert("NO EXISTE PROVINCIA");
	}
	cargarCiudadesPorProvincia(todos);
}

function ErrorPartidos()
{
	alert("No se pueden cargar los partidos");
}

function PoblarPartidos()
{
	var lista = document.getElementById("partido");
	var documento_xml = this.req.responseXML;
	var partidos = documento_xml.getElementsByTagName("partidos")[0];
	var partido = partidos.getElementsByTagName("partido");
	lista.options.length = 0;
	if(partido.length==0 || partidos_todos)
	{
		var codigo = "";
		var nombre = "-- TODOS --";
		lista.options[0] = new Option(nombre,codigo);
	}
	for(i=0;i<partido.length;i++)
	{
		var codigo = partido[i].getElementsByTagName("codigo")[0].firstChild.nodeValue;
		var nombre = partido[i].getElementsByTagName("descripcion")[0].firstChild.nodeValue;
		posicion = (partidos_todos?1:0)
		lista.options[(i+partidos_todos)] = new Option(nombre,codigo);
	}
	
	
}
